MISSION STATEMENT

The Wyoming Autism taskforce strives to coordinate capacity building strategies to support all individuals with or at risk for autism spectrum disorders, their families and those serving them, to achieve a fulfilling and productive life within their communities. These goals will be met in the following ways:

  • Coordination between educational, developmental, medical, and allied health services will be supported.

  • Parents, caregivers, educators, child care providers and health care providers will be provided with current, evidence based information on screening, identification, assessment, and intervention strategies for individuals with or at risk for autism spectrum disorders across their lifespan.

  • Parents, caregivers, educators, child care providers and health care providers will be provided with advocacy training.

  • Comprehensive evaluation services developed over time and including medical, developmental, educational, and behavioral components will be supported.

  • Parents/families will be included at every level to provide lifelong interventions for the success and independence of their children. They will have access to information and education about autism spectrum disorders and will be supported in their advocacy for their children and their families.
